10/10! I am always skeptical of a hotel bar, but it was so awesome. You can access the bar from the courtyard or the lobby, it was super cute and had a fun vibe. The bartender was amazing, and the drinks were excellent. My husband went back the next day and ate dinner there, and said it was good as well. If I find myself in Tucson again, I will be back!

Very cool diamond in the rough in south Tucson. It’s the bar/lounge of a motel but with a cool eclectic vibe. We went on a Friday and several local artisans and craftsmen had small tables selling their art/crafts. The cocktails were good as was the beer selections. White wine options were great but they were out of a few reds today. The elote corn “ribs” were a delight and the loaded fries great. Will def come back! VictorB

There was a time when the idea of fish tacos was “eh” at best then having had Chef Nico’s fish tacos at the Red Light Lounge everything changed. The tacos were perfectly crisp, seasoned to perfection and dreamy. Have had numerous fish tacos since that encounter with Chef Nico’s fish tacos and not one has come even close to what he has created. His entire menu is fresh, innovative takes on classics such as buffalo wings with cotija and a cilantro lime aioli. A decadent and delicious Indian Fry Bread and even salads packed with Southwest flavor. The only regret is having not made it back in yet to try the newly launched breakfast menu.
